The term of this appointment is July 2024 to February 2025.

Successful applicants will actively engage in facilitating delivery of the education in the undergraduate and postgraduate midwifery programmes within a Te Tiriti honouring framework.  In addition, they will be invited to contribute to the supervision of postgraduate students enrolled in the Masters and Doctoral programmes.  There is an expectation that appointees will also contribute to the research culture within the Faculty of Health and Environmental Sciences at AUT University.

Applicants will hold a Doctoral qualification in health or science and will have a strong midwifery clinical background. The successful applicant will have a relevant teaching experience. Candidates will embrace the vision and values of the School and commit to ongoing professional development supported by the AUT staff development programme.

The successful applicant will:

  • Model best clinical, teaching and research practice
  • Inspire and support students' achievement
  • communicate effectively
  • Demonstrate writing skills that demonstrate linguistic sophistication
  • have competent organisational and IT skills
  • Have a commitment to honouring te Tiriti o Waitangi
